Upcoming Guidance for First Lady Michelle Obama

Thursday, January 21

Washington, DC * 11:30AM – As part of the Joining Forces initiative, First Lady Michelle Obama will deliver remarks at the 84th Winter Meeting of the United States Conference of Mayors at the Capital Hilton. Mrs. Obama will speak about the Administration's efforts to end veteran homelessness and the importance of mayoral leadership in the process.

In 2010, the Administration set the goal of preventing and ending homelessness among veterans. Through the Mayors Challenge to End Veteran Homelessness, launched in 2014, more than 800 mayors and other state and local leaders across the country have committed to marshal federal, local, and non-profit efforts to end veteran homelessness in their communities.
